Advertising jokes about coronavirus origin, investigation opened (ANSA) The ad for an Australian company in which a man eats a bat sandwich and jokes that it was this food practice that gave rise to the coronavirus pandemic is destined to further aggravate relations between Australia and China .  The Australian advertising authority has opened an investigation into the spot, which has had over 200,000 views on Youtube . Boating Camping Fishing, a company that sells fishing and leisure equipment, defended the idea by calling it ironic.

"Of course we realize the gravity of the situation but we have always made irreverent advertisements with the intention of making people smile," a spokesman explained to the BBC.

It is not the first time

that a Boating Camping Fishing campaign has been targeted by the Authority.

In 2016 and 2018, two of their advertisements were named the most criticized of the year. 

There

has been much discussion on the

origin of Covid-19

from bats, especially at the beginning of the epidemic in China, when the first cases of coronavirus were linked to the Wuhan wildlife market.

However the exact origin of the virus has not yet been determined.
